Output 043871d11099862aadbec86f696fc4c7931045ad4f6065b510c0f557af815f89:1

value
303390712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e327e28c1c42160d8e1a450a71b4412a8cc600a6 OP_EQUAL
address
3NQ76Lv8ft3jZKKmTGGZs6dh63VtrzfzH3
transaction
043871d11099862aadbec86f696fc4c7931045ad4f6065b510c0f557af815f89
spent
true